Greek Rosarte children's choir wins gold in World Choir Games
- Written by E.Tsiliopoulos
The Rosarte children's choir won two gold medals at the 10th World Choir Games that was held in Tshwane, South Africa on 5 and 6 June with the participation of 500 choirs from all over the world.
The Greek choir, under the direction of Greek maestro Rosie Mastrosavva, competed in two categories and impressed the judges and the audience. Rosarte was first in the category C2 Children's Choir/Mixed Boys Choirs and in C16 Musica Sacra with accompaniment.
In the 16 years since its foundation the children's choir Rosarte has won many distinctions and awards, initially as children's choir of ERA (Greek public radio) and later as the children's choir of the municipality of Athens under the direction of Rosie Mastrosavva.
